Total knee replacement (TKR) is a surgical procedure in which damaged cartilage and bone from the knee joint are replaced with artificial components. Procedure Steps
- Pre-operative evaluation and imaging (X-ray / MRI)
- Anaesthesia administration (spinal or general)
- Removal of damaged cartilage and bone surfaces
- Implantation of metal and polyethylene components
- Wound closure and drain placement
- Physiotherapy starting Day 1 post-surgery
Recovery & Stay
Expected Recovery Time: 6–8 weeks
